Call for Expressions of Interest - Independent Members of Council’s Assessment Panel
Closing date 6 March 2022

Adelaide Hills Council is seeking expressions of interest from suitably qualified and experienced members of the public to sit on the Council Assessment Panel (CAP). The CAP is an important committee of Council with responsibility for assessing a wide range of Development Applications including new houses, land divisions, major commercial developments and changes in land uses. It has a very significant role as an assessment authority assessing development proposals against the Planning and Design Code.

The CAP consists of four independent members and one Councillor, pursuant to the Planning, Development and Infrastructure Act 2016. The CAP meets monthly – usually 6:30pm on the second Wednesday of every month in Stirling.

The Council is seeking four independent members (including an independent presiding member) with knowledge of the Adelaide Hills Council area, a keen interest in planning, qualifications in urban and regional planning or similar, and accreditation as an Accredited Professional – Planning Level 2, pursuant to the Planning, Development and Infrastructure Act 2016.

The Presiding Member will also need to have significant experience in chairing meetings and a working knowledge of the Planning, Development and Infrastructure Act 2016 and Planning, Development and Infrastructure (General) Regulations 2017.

Council pays sitting fees for the independent members of CAP. Ordinary independent members will be paid a sitting fee of $380 (excl. GST) per meeting while the Presiding Member will be paid $500 (excl. GST) per meeting. These fees are reviewed bi-annually.
